The Drone Industry’s Critical Pivot: Scaling Up for Sustainable Growth

The era of experimental prototypes in the autonomous aerial systems sector is drawing to a close. As demand from defense and industrial clients accelerates, the central challenge for companies has shifted. The market now demands proof that innovative drone technology can be manufactured reliably at an industrial scale. For investors, this evolution means the investment thesis is moving beyond visionary concepts to scrutinize the hard metrics of mass production and operational execution.

Manufacturing and Strategic Alliances Take Center Stage

A company’s ability to industrialize its manufacturing processes is under intense scrutiny. In a fiercely competitive global landscape, the resilience and efficiency of localized supply chains have emerged as critical drivers for future expansion. Strategic partnerships with established players in infrastructure or defense are increasingly viewed as key catalysts for growth. These alliances serve a dual purpose: they act as a powerful validation of a firm’s technology within the industry, and through multi-year service agreements, they provide a foundation for more predictable and stable financial planning.

The Consolidation and Technology Shift

The sector is undergoing a period of consolidation, with firms actively seeking capital to scale their research and production capabilities. Technological benchmarks are also rising. The integration of AI-native platforms into drone hardware is now considered a baseline expectation rather than a unique selling point. Current market attention is particularly focused on two areas: heavy-lift drones capable of remote infrastructure maintenance and localized, highly secure surveillance systems. Success hinges on a company’s proven reliability in complex operational scenarios and its adeptness at navigating an evolving regulatory landscape.

From Pilot Programs to Widespread Deployment

The definitive benchmark for commercial success today is the transition from limited pilot programs to broad, scalable deployments. Market analysts are increasingly evaluating a firm’s stability based on its operational capacity to convert a growing order book into realized revenue efficiently. In a field where technological advancement continues at a rapid pace, the ability to scale operations effectively is what will ultimately separate the industry leaders from the laggards.

The medium- to long-term viability of players in the drone market will be determined by one core factor: the translation of technological prowess into sustainable, project-based growth that is evidenced by clear operational milestones and commercial traction.
